Talkspace, Inc. (NASDAQ: TALK) is making waves in the rapidly growing digital healthcare sector. As a virtual behavioral healthcare company, Talkspace connects patients with licensed mental health providers via an innovative online platform, offering services that include psychotherapy and psychiatry. With a market capitalization of $607.91 million, Talkspace is a key player in the health information services industry. Its stock currently trades at $3.63, providing a potential upside of 33.81% based on the average analyst target price of $4.86.

Talkspace’s recent performance has been noteworthy, with a revenue growth of 25.30%. This surge underscores the increasing demand for online mental health services, a trend that has been accelerated by the global shift towards digital solutions in healthcare. The company’s offering of therapy through messaging, audio, and video channels has resonated well in the market. However, it’s important to note that Talkspace’s financials reveal a negative free cash flow of $6,745,625.00, indicating that while growth is strong, the company is still navigating the path to profitability.

The stock’s performance over the past year shows resilience, with a 52-week range between $2.27 and $4.17. Despite the absence of traditional valuation metrics like P/E and PEG ratios, Talkspace’s strategic positioning in a burgeoning market offers a compelling investment narrative. The company’s return on equity stands at 3.74%, and its earnings per share (EPS) is reported at $0.03.

Analyst sentiment towards Talkspace is predominantly positive, with seven buy ratings and only one hold rating. The absence of sell ratings highlights a strong confidence in the company’s growth trajectory. The target price range for Talkspace is between $3.50 and $6.00, suggesting room for significant appreciation from its current price point.

Technical indicators paint a moderately optimistic picture. The stock’s 50-day moving average is $3.26, while the 200-day moving average is $2.89, suggesting a positive momentum. Moreover, the Relative Strength Index (RSI) of 53.61 indicates that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old. The MACD and Signal Line both stand at 0.11, further supporting a neutral to slightly bullish outlook.

As Talkspace continues to expand its reach by serving health insurance plans, employee assistance programs, direct-to-enterprise customers, and individual subscribers, the company is well-positioned to capitalize on the growing need for accessible mental health services.
